Investigator: DNA could identify 2 Tulsa massacre victims

Summary by Ground News
Remains were removed from Oaklawn Cemetery a year ago. DNA sequencing is expected to begin in July or August. A match to a family member could be made within days if the descendant is in Intermountain Forensics' DNA database. None of the remains are confirmed as victims of the 1921 massacre.
